Nonsense. Most of you will be voting for JT next election. The next
Conservative leader is likely to be either Kelly Leitch or Kevin
O'Leary, and given the choice between one of those two or the Liberals
(or the NDP which -- as always -- threatens to split the vote) you
will fall in line. 

The Liberals are not fools. They understand that ticking off the
electoral reform nerds is a dangerous gambit, because often we are the
ones staffing their campaigns. But if the Conservative campaign plays
out the way it appears to be, the Liberals know they are on safe
ground.

By all means, let's make our threats. I will be calling Raj Saini to
make mine as well. But let's also be aware that those threats are
hollow.
